The Beaver Lodge

A private grant to the Coeur d'Alene Public Library made possible this beaver lodge and companion mural of a dreamlike forest with wildlife. Allen and Mary Dee created this piece for children to enjoy while reading beneath the sticks and logs of the lodge. The mural is approximately fifty feet in length and about nine feet tall. The lodge is constructed of pine and fir, carved and painted to coordinate with the mural. beaver-lodge2.jpg

Ketchum Community Library Totem

A piece commissioned by the Pearson family, this totem entitled "Ancient Tales" now resides in the childrens section of the wonderful Ketchum Community Library. Carved and constructed of pine and fir, it represents a jungle ruin and some of the wildlife therein. Monkeys frolic, a panther peers out and birds of all types populate the place. At the base of the totem is a jaguar head whose open mouth is a playspace for small kids. The whole is painted by Mary Dee in vibrant acrylic colors.

Coeur d'Alene Public Library Totem

This totemic piece is installed in the childrens section of the new Coeur d'Alene Public Library. It stands nine feet tall and is divided into two sections by the check-out counter. Below the counter are the underwater creatures and above are the land and air creatures. It is made by Allen of entirely of local recycled wood and painted by Mary Dee in acrylics.
